Course Description:
Optimization problems arise in various fields ranging from economics to physics and in our daily lives. Airlines arrange their schedules to maximize their profit subject to constraints imposed by limited resources such as number of crew-members and planes. Ray of light follows a path to minimize the travel time.

 Two main ingredients of an optimization problem are
  • an objective function which we want to minimize or maximize,
  • a set of constraints which determines the set of allowable points over which the objective function must be minimized or maximized.
The first part of this course will focus on unconstrained optimization problems in the absence of constraints. Constrained optimization problems will be considered in the second part. For both cases we will derive the optimality conditions (i.e. conditions that distinguish an optimal point from an ordinary point), introduce numerical algorithms to locate points satisfying the optimality conditions and analyze the convergence properties of the numerical algorithms.
